>>14451638
I'm someone who likes him and he's very variable, Broken Empire is pretty hated because of how comically edgy it is, it actually makes it hard to maintain interest. This does get explained somewhat by the finale of book 1 but the sequels are less gripping imo.
Red Queens War is an attempt to write a more mature work in the same fantasy world and it largely works even if the shift is from edginess to borderline grating pessimism/cowardice.
Red Sister is a move into more traditional fantasy albeit one set in a world with a scifi/dying earth background. I like it best out of what I've read from him.

He's a solid writer overall but one who has yet to produce a really great standout work imo.

>>14452753
I'm not sure which volume(s) contain the Zothique stories but most earlier Smith stories are worth reading and the first volume of the Collected Fantasies would be a fine place to start. Alternatively, you could sample his work for a dollar with The Dark Eidolon and Other Fantasies on kindle. Zothique is just one setting/cycle and is a dying earth influenced supercontinent, Averoigne is a fantastic medieval France inspired province and the Hyperborea stories occur in a prehistoric lost continent influenced by Lovecraft and Howard. I just prioritized recommending the Zothique stories because they're the ones I enjoyed the most except for a handful of the Hyperborea ones.

>>14458565
Imager's probably my best rec for this, it's a hyper specific magic based around being able to remove/move small objects you can see and being able to create some small things.
First series is a cop story about a guy coming into his power, going to magic school and then solving political intrigue.
Second series (which fits what you want the most) is set in the past and is the guy who eventually founds said school figuring out how to use his powers to the fullest.
He starts off nearly killing himself to make coins and buy the third or fourth book in the sequence he's training troops on how to use the power in war.

Others that kinda fit:
Discworld-Rincewind novels
A company of strangers (not that good as a series but the mc is basically a D&D wizard who only has utility spells so it fits perfectly)
Spellslinger (kinda aimed towards YA but it's about a guy with incredibly limited magic in a world where magic is tied to your hometown working out how to use what little he has after being exiled)

>>14458888
I like Sanderson overall and I think most of his hate is nonsense forced here by a few individuals when there're worse writers that the thread seems to like, but there's a lot to complain about with him.
The power scale in his story often slips to this point where there's over the top fantasy combat that rips you away from the actual narrative for nothing, thus the comparisons to shonen anime, since his characters will start screaming at each other while they throw around big magical sword swings. It's not inherently bad on its own, but it plays poorly with what I'd call a strength of his, which is more grounded consistent world building since it creates this awkward division in how much magic is supposed to be this structured science he likes it to be and how much it's supposed to be high mysticism in the setting.
His pacing his issues and you're often forced to drag yourself through long periods of transition to get into the meat of the story. He doesn't really understand how to build suspense, so you're not left anticipating, you're left tired, needing to move onto the next bit but unable to skip anything since he might try to slip something of note in slow chapters.
His worst offence is his awful dialogue though. He has some cool snips of heroic declarations, and then everything else is awful. He likes to include these witty characters who're witty because you're told they're sooooo witty, when they have nothing witty to say. They'll throw out some bit of a snark that reads like a teenager trying to bite back at his teacher and then everyone commends them, and you're left putting down the book so you can contemplate killing yourself for reading something so embarrassing.
